We will need:

  1. About 2 meters of leather cord (2 mm) (the length depends on how many times you want to wrap the bracelet around your wrist. 2 meters of lace will allow you to make about 4 turns of the bracelet),
  2. 1.5 meters of leather cord (1 mm),
  3. 6 meters of leather cord (1 mm),
  4. About 140 small beads with a hole large enough to thread a narrower (1mm) leather cord through,
  5. a beautiful button (optional).

Of course, you can use leather laces of other diameters, the main thing is that they can be threaded into beads.

So let's get started! The bracelet on the right (photo above) does not have a button and will be fastened with a loop at one end and a knot at the other.

First, take a 2 meter long cord and fold it in half.

Now we take a cord 1.5 meters long and tie it in a knot around the loop as shown in picture 1.

Then we lean the short end of the lace (on the left in the picture) against the center, and tightly wrap the long end around the base of the bracelet in order to make a beautiful beginning.

It is very important to work carefully as the laces are very thin and can break. You can first practice strength on some other lace.

Now tie a knot as shown in picture 2.

Then we put all the beads on the long end of the cord (the one with a diameter of 1 mm) and tie a knot at the end so that the beads do not move out while working.

As for the short tip (the same cord with a diameter of 1 mm), it can be cut off or inserted into the first bead if the hole size allows.

So, let's move our first bead up.

Now take a 6-meter cord and cut it into 2 identical parts (DO NOT CUT). For example, they can be wound into balls, as shown in picture 1 on the left.

We tie a knot (from a 6-meter cord) directly under the first bead.

Well, now you need to carefully follow the steps shown in pictures 4 to 14

At first there is a chance of doing something wrong, but don’t worry, you need to carefully undo what you’ve done and start again with the second bead. Or maybe everything will work out right away.

It is very important to alternate weaving “above” and on the next bead “under” the thin cord in the middle (which has beads). It is necessary to maintain alternation in order to secure the beads well and beautifully between two thicker cords (2 mm wide).

Well, do you see the alternation?

You can easily get the hang of it because this process looks more complicated than it actually is!

Don’t forget to periodically wrap the bracelet around your wrist to see its length.

Finally, place 1 end of the braided lace in the center (for example, the left one), and wrap the other end around all the other laces. Then we make a knot as at the beginning of the bracelet, shown in picture 4.

Now we take all the ends and tie them into a large knot. Pull it tight. Depending on the length you need, you can skip a little space and tie another knot and another, as shown in the last picture.

If you are using a button on the other end of the bracelet, the distance between the two knots will be the button loop.

OK it's all over Now! Your hand-woven leather bracelet is ready!

A couple more options for the creative process “How to make leather bracelets”

You will need:

- leather laces - you can use thin leather ribbons
- floss threads
- glue
- scissors
- scotch
- needle

Step 1
Measure your wrist by wrapping the leather cord loosely around your wrist twice, then add an extra 10cm to tie it. Glue one end of the leather cord to the surface so that it does not move and, stepping back about 5 cm from the edge, drop a drop of glue onto the leather cord and attach your first color of floss to it.
Step 2
Continue winding the floss around the leather cord until you have a strip of the width you want, then cut off the rest of the thread, securing the end to the bracelet.
Step 3
Take a different color of thread and do the same procedure with it again. Continue doing steps 2 and 3 until you have done about 5cm of different colors.
Step 4
When you're done wrapping, take the needle and pass it under yours. If you want, you can add a small drop of glue to make sure your floss doesn't come off.

Step 5
Tie the end of the lace that is closest to the wrap around the other end of the lace. Make a simple knot. The knot should be strong, but the leather lace should pass freely back and forth and slide through it.
Advice: Before tying a leather lace, wet it a little and remember it to make it softer and easier to tie. This will also help make a strong knot.
Step 6
Leaving at least 10cm on the other side, repeat steps 1, 2, 3, and 4 again.
Step 7
When you have finished wrapping the other side of your bracelet, re-tie the loose end on the other side.

You will get wonderful multi-colored bracelets.

Therefore, first you need to cleanse the skin. Since you need a small piece, the simplest recipe will do. You will need:

  • water;
  • soap;
  • ammonia;
  • cotton swab.

Dissolve about 10 g of soap in half a glass of water. Add 1 tbsp. l. ammonia. Wipe the piece with this mixture and let it dry.

Scuff marks and uneven paint are also fairly easy to deal with. To do this, you need to look at the nearest shoe store and see what leather dyes they have. They usually come in aerosol packaging, sometimes in plastic bottles with a brush attached. Renew the piece and you can start making leather bracelets with your own hands.

DIY leather bracelets for men

Perhaps this is the simplest version of leather jewelry. It is made from a rectangular strip. You need to prepare:

  • a piece of leather;
  • hammer;
  • set of buttons;
  • set for inserting buttons;
  • tape measure;
  • ball pen;
  • ruler (preferably iron);
  • square;
  • cardboard;
  • pins;
  • thick needle or awl.

Important! The number of buttons depends on the width of the decoration. You can make the clasp with one button or two or three. In addition, you can decorate a men's leather bracelet with one or two buttons.

Sample:

  1. Measure your wrist circumference. Since the fastener will have buttons, you need to add another one and a half to two centimeters so that the edges can be overlapped.
  2. Determine the width of the future product. There is no need to leave any allowances here. The optimal width of a men's bracelet is 4-5 cm, but it can be more.
  3. Draw a rectangle on the cardboard according to the measurements.
  4. Cut it out (it is better to do this using a metal ruler with a sharp knife).

Important! For the template, it is better to take thin but rigid cardboard. This is especially important if you are planning to make an openwork product.

We cut the bracelet

Now the template needs to be transferred to the skin:

  1. Place the skin outside down.
  2. Apply the template.
  3. Trace it with a ballpoint pen.
  4. Cut with a sharp knife.

Important! You can cut either using a template or using a ruler. In principle, you can do without a cardboard pattern if the piece of leather is smooth and its corners are straight (for example, a fragment of an old belt).

Buttons and what to do with them

It’s not difficult to figure out the buttons – you can immediately see which part should be on top and which on the bottom. In principle, you can go to an atelier or sewing store, where they probably have a device that allows you to do this in a few minutes. But there is nothing difficult about putting these elements on a men’s leather bracelet with your own hands.

Important! In the set for inserting buttons you will find a black circle - it is placed under the product so as not to scratch the table. There is a piece of rod there - without it you cannot install the button. In general, it is not difficult to understand which part is needed for what.

We pierce holes

You already have the blank, now you need to figure out where to make the holes. To do this, put the bracelet on your wrist and make marks. Tailor's pins are best suited for this purpose:

  1. Insert one pin from the edge of the workpiece that is on top.
  2. Insert the second pin into the corner below.
  • Holes in leather are perfectly made by the most ordinary office hole punch.
  • If it is not there, you will have to do it with an awl or a gypsy needle.

In any case, the hole should be the same size as from the hole punch.

We put buttons

Now - the most important thing. Each button consists of six parts - two main parts and four attachments. You need to start inserting from the part that will be on top. The upper main part looks like a mushroom - it has a cap and a short stem:

  1. Insert the leg into the hole so that the cap is on the outside.
  2. Put on the attachments - the one with the thread should be on top.
  3. Clamp it all together with pliers or a special press.
  4. Insert the bottom of the button in the same way.

Important! The cap of the button should align with the recess in the nozzle.

Decorating the bracelet

Actually, a men's leather bracelet made with your own hands is ready. But if you wish, you can decorate it. For example, insert a couple more buttons in different places. You can do it differently - decorate the decoration with a simple overlaid geometric pattern.

You will need:

  • multi-colored pieces of leather;
  • leather glue;
  • scissors;
  • ball pen;
  • ruler.

Make several elements - for example, brown triangles and white squares. It is best to draw them with a ballpoint pen on the wrong side. Cut out the elements. Place them on the bracelet, and then glue them with leather glue or universal glue according to the instructions.

DIY braided leather bracelet

A simple but effective decoration. For such a bracelet you will need a strip of leather approximately one and a half times longer than the circumference of the wrist. Think in advance how your product will fit on your wrist:

  • lace-up;
  • on a buckle;
  • on a button or button.

To weave a bracelet you will need:

  • strip of leather 2-5 cm wide;
  • sharp knife;
  • metal ruler;
  • ball pen.

Option 1

A three-strand bracelet is woven like a regular braid:

  1. Mark the wrong side of the strip, dividing it widthwise into 3 equal parts. It is better to draw with a ballpoint pen on the wrong side.
  2. Cut the strands, not reaching about 1 cm from the edge.
  3. Place the strip right side up.
  4. Take the left strand.
  5. Pass it over the second and under the third.
  6. Take the strand that is now on the left.
  7. Pass it over the second strand and under the third
  8. Weave this way until there are 2 cm left to the end.
  9. Sew the strands together to create a continuous fabric.
  10. Attach the clasp.

Important! If the bracelet will be held on a button, make an air loop from leather or thick threads. In the same way, you can weave a belt or leather bracelet with your own hands from any number of strands.

Option 2

A decoration in which only the middle strands are intertwined, while the outer ones remain straight, will look very impressive - they can be made a little wider than the middle ones.

Master class on making a leather bracelet:

  1. Divide the strip into 5 parts.
  2. Cut in the same way as in the previous case, that is, leaving an uncut piece of approximately 1 cm.
  3. Draw the second strand from the left over the third and under the fourth.
  4. Don't touch the last strand.
  5. Draw the strand that is now second from the left in the same way as the previous one.
  6. Braid until there is 1cm left to the edge, then sew the strands together. The extreme ones can be shortened a little.

Option 3

It is not necessary to make a braid along the entire length of the bracelet. You can first braid a braid 2-3 cm long, then leave a gap, braid the braid again, etc.

Option 4

You can make a braided lace bracelet. Weave the decoration. Make holes along the edges - one or two at a time - and insert a thin leather cord.

Bracelet with voluminous decorations

If you wish, you can make a leather bracelet with voluminous flowers. For this you need:

  • strip of leather;
  • pieces of leather of the same or a different color;
  • leather glue;
  • scissors;
  • sample;
  • pan.

How to proceed:

  1. Make a bracelet from a strip of leather and attach a clasp to it.
  2. To decorate your product, cut out petals - circles or ovals of the same size - from pieces of leather. It is better to do this according to a template.
  3. Place the petals inside out on a clean, cold frying pan. Begin to heat the pan slowly. The petals will bend. Once they have the desired shape, carefully assemble them.
  4. Combine 3-4 petals into a flower, and then glue or sew on the bracelet.

Important! The middle can also be made from a piece of leather, a bead, seed beads, or even a colored feather.

Openwork bracelet

It is made almost the same way as a strip bracelet. Only the strip is something like leather lace.

Important! To make such jewelry you need a very precise template - strictly according to the size of the bracelet.

All sorts of holes are cut into the template - flowers, petals, Celtic weave, and basically anything you like. Then the template needs to be placed on a strip of leather, fastened so that the pattern does not move out, outline future holes and carefully cut out. The clasp can be made with buttons or lacing.

Experienced craftsmen and craftswomen know that when creating bracelets it is very important to choose the right leather material. For each of the patterns for weaving bracelets with your own hands, you need to select the appropriate type of leather material.

So, to create thick, large leather bracelets, it would be correct to give preference to a rough type of leather: saddle or crust. To create men's bracelets, saddle leather is most often used.

For the manufacture of thin, elegant woven leather accessories for women, leatherette is most suitable. This material is softer in texture and is easy to process with needles and hole punches.

We quickly and easily create leather bracelets for men: the manufacturing process

Men's leather bracelets are distinguished by their simplicity and laconicism compared to women's ones.

We invite you to learn how to weave a simple men's leather bracelet. To work, you will need a piece of leather five centimeters wide and about twenty centimeters long.

Start making the bracelet:

  1. Form the pattern of the product on the back of the leather. The length of the bracelet must be at least nineteen centimeters. Make two slits in the middle, not reaching the edges by 1.5-2 centimeters.
  2. Place the workpiece vertically and, using a washable pencil, number the cords from one to three. Bring the bottom edge of the bracelet between the second and third cords.
  3. Straighten the leather laces as you weave along. Continue weaving in the following order: the first cord with the second, the third with the first, the second with the third.
  4. Bring the bottom of the workpiece forward between the third and second laces.
  5. Place the cords again so that the lines go down to the bottom of the weave in the correct order - first, second, third cord.
  6. Repeat steps two through four. You should end up with a braided look. Give the desired shape to the edges of the bracelet and use an awl to make holes.
  7. To make the fastener, glue several pieces of leather together and leave to dry for a day. After drying, round the edges, make a hole in the middle and smooth out any rough edges with sandpaper.
  8. Thread a thin leather cord through the holes in the bracelet. Pull both edges through the resulting leather nut. Tie the edges of the lace with knots.

Creative bracelet with iron clasp

This creative leather bracelet is made quite quickly and is perfect for practicing the first steps in working with leather.

We will need:

  • Metal clasp (you don’t have to use exactly the same one as ours, any one will do)
  • Hole puncher
  • Hammer or button inserter
  • Rivets
  • Scissors or breadboard knife
  • Ruler
  • Varnish (optional)
  • Glue (optional)

How to make a leather bracelet for men with an iron clasp?

Step 1

Cut a strip of leather 5 cm larger than the wrist. The width should be 2 cm larger than the fastener. To do this we use a knife or scissors.

Step 2

We bend 2.5 cm of leather on each side (we cut off the excess, so we ended up with a larger fold). You can glue it, or you can leave it as is

Step 3

We wrap the wrist, attach the clasp and put marks on the place where it is attached

Step 4

Punch holes using a hole punch (as a last resort, you can use a knife) and insert rivets, driving them in with a hammer

*The main thing is to choose the required diameter of the rivets so that they are larger than the hole in the fastener

Step 5

We repeat the same thing on the other side.

Step 6

If desired, the bracelet can be varnished
